What Exactly Are Acrylic Markers Michaels, Anyway?

Ever walked into Michaels with a half-baked art idea, only to leave with a cart full of stuff you didn’t know you needed—like, ever? That’s the magic of it. But if you’ve stood in front of the marker aisle squinting at labels that say “acrylic markers michaels,” wondering if they’re just fancy pens or actual art tools, you’re not alone, eh? These bad boys are basically paint in pen form—vibrant, waterproof, blendable, and ready to rock on just about any surface that doesn’t run screaming. Unlike your average Sharpie, acrylic markers michaels use pigment-rich, water-based acrylic paint that dries fast, stays put, and layers like a dream. Think of ‘em as your tiny, portable mini-brush that never needs cleaning. Perfect for those “I’m-feeling-artsy-but-my-brushes-are-still-soaking” moments.


Are Acrylic Markers and Acrylic Paint Markers the Same Thing?

“Wait, so… are acrylic markers michaels different from acrylic paint markers?” Good question, mate—though honestly, in Canada, we mostly just say “dude, does it work or not?” Truth is, the terms are used interchangeably more often than Timbits at a hockey game. Technically, both refer to markers filled with acrylic paint instead of ink. But here’s the tea: some brands market “acrylic markers” as student-grade (lighter pigment, thinner flow), while “acrylic paint markers” often imply professional-grade (opaque, creamy, rich). At Michaels, though? Their acrylic markers michaels line-up usually leans pro—especially the Posca, Molotow, and their in-house Artist’s Loft series. So yeah, same beast, different hoodie.

Can You Really Use Acrylic Markers on Canvas? Like, For Real?

Oh, absolutely—and this is where acrylic markers michaels shine like a moose in moonlight. Canvas? Yep. Primed, raw, stretched, rolled—it don’t matter. The paint grips the fibers, dries fast without bleed-through (if you’re not goin’ full Jackson Pollock), and layers beautifully for texture or corrections. Some folks even use ‘em for underdrawings before slapping on heavy-body acrylics. Just give the canvas a light gesso coat if it’s raw, and you’re golden. Pro tip: let each layer dry fully before stacking—otherwise, you’ll smudge your masterpiece into a sad, colourful ghost. Bottom line? Acrylic markers michaels on canvas = ✅. No cap.


What’s the Whole Range of Acrylic Markers Michaels Actually Offers?

Michaels ain’t playin’ around when it comes to acrylic markers michaels. You’ve got options for every budget and vibe. Here’s a quick breakdown:

BrandTip TypesPrice Range (CAD)Best For
PoscaBrush, bullet, chisel, extra-fine$3.99–$8.99Detail work, murals, mixed media
Molotow ONE4ALLInterchangeable tips$5.49–$12.99Street art, layering, professionals
Artist’s Loft (Michaels’ house brand)Bullet, chisel$1.99–$4.99Beginners, students, quick projects

Yeah, it’s basically a rainbow buffet of creative fuel. And if you’ve got that weekly 40% off coupon (we all do, c’mon), you can snag a whole set for less than a fancy coffee run. The key? Match the marker to your mission. Want buttery-smooth blending? Go Molotow. Need crisp lines for zine doodles? Posca’s your guy. Just messin’ around? Artist’s Loft’ll get you there—no stress, eh.

Do Acrylic Markers Michaels Work on Other Surfaces Too?

Hell yeah—they’re basically the duct tape of the art world: sticks to *everything*. Wood? Sure. Glass? Yep. Rocks, fabric, plastic, metal, sneakers, old records, your dog’s (willing) collar? Go nuts. The secret sauce is surface prep. Glossy stuff like glass or ceramic? Light sand + rubbing alcohol = instant grip. Fabric? Heat-set after drying (iron on low, no steam). And always—*always*—do a test patch. ‘Cause nothin’ hurts more than finishing your magnum opus on a thrifted mug, only to watch it peel off in the dishwasher like last year’s New Year’s resolution. With acrylic markers michaels, versatility isn’t a perk—it’s the whole point.


How Long Do Acrylic Markers Michaels Last Before Drying Out?

Depends who you ask—and how you treat ‘em. If you’re like us and leave caps off like it’s a personality trait, yeah, they’ll croak faster than a frog in February. But treat ‘em right? A well-cared-for acrylic markers michaels can last *years*. Posca and Molotow even let you replace nibs or refill paint. Artist’s Loft? Less so—but at that price, you’re probably not crying over it. Pro habits: store ‘em horizontal (not upright!), shake ‘em before use (they’ve got a little ball inside—listen for the rattle!), and *always* recap immediately. Oh, and if it clogs? Soak the tip in warm water for 10 mins. 9 times outta 10, it’ll come back like it never left. Resilient little buggers, really.

Common Mistakes People Make With Acrylic Markers Michaels (And How to Avoid ‘Em)

Oh, we’ve all been there: shook the marker like it owes us money, but got a watery dribble. Or pressed too hard and blew out the nib like it’s a birthday candle. Classic rookie moves. Here’s what *not* to do with your acrylic markers michaels:

– **Don’t skip the shake**. Seriously, that little metal ball? It mixes the pigment. No shake = faded lines.
– **Don’t press like you’re mad at the paper**. These aren’t ballpoints. Gentle, consistent pressure = clean flow.
– **Don’t layer wet-on-wet unless you *want* smudges**. Acrylic paint reactivates with moisture—so let it dry!
– **Don’t store them tip-down**. Gravity pulls paint to the nib, clogging it over time.

Follow these, and your acrylic markers michaels will treat you like the artist you are—not the frustrated scribbler you pretend to be on Tuesdays.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does Michaels carry acrylic paint markers?

Yes, Michaels absolutely carries acrylic markers michaels—including popular brands like Posca, Molotow, and their own Artist’s Loft line. You’ll find them in the painting or marker aisle, both in-store and online, with options for beginners and pros alike.

What are acrylic markers used for?

Acrylic markers michaels are incredibly versatile—they’re used for everything from canvas painting and journaling to customizing sneakers, rock art, glassware, and even murals. Their opaque, fast-drying paint works on porous and non-porous surfaces, making them a go-to for mixed-media artists and hobbyists across Canada.

Do acrylic markers work on canvas?

Absolutely! Acrylic markers michaels adhere beautifully to both primed and raw canvas. They’re perfect for sketching, detailing, or even full compositions—just let each layer dry before adding more to avoid smudging. Many artists use them for underpainting or final line work on canvas pieces.

Is there a difference between acrylic markers and acrylic paint markers?

In practice, not really—the terms “acrylic markers” and “acrylic paint markers” are often used interchangeably in Canada and beyond. Both contain acrylic paint instead of ink. However, some brands use “paint markers” to signal higher pigment concentration or professional-grade quality. At Michaels, acrylic markers michaels generally refer to the full spectrum, from student to pro lines.
